The Federal Reserve has advanced its proposal to end crypto debanking by starting a 2-month comment period on a proposed rule on bank supervision. This is the strongest move yet in a policy change that crypto supporters claim will put Operation Chokepoint 2.0 to rest. Federal Reserve Seeks Public Feedback to End Operation Chokepoint 2.0
